Main content starts here, tab to start navigating

Hours & Location

2415 Centreville Road,
Herndon, VA 20171 (opens in a new tab)

571-430-3399

Sunday - Thursday
9:00am - 9:00pm

Friday - Saturday
9:00am - 10:00pm

Get Directions (opens in a new tab)